
ELKHART, IN – University of Jamestown senior divers Jada Shorter and Becky Czarnecki earned All-American status at the NAIA Swimming & Diving Championships, which concluded Saturday at the Elkhart Health & Aquatics Center.
Shorter was second in the 1 meter competition with a score of 216.65 and fifth in the 3 meter event with 164.95. Shorter is a five-time All-American, including four times in 1m and the 2023 national championship.
Czarnecki, making her first national meet appearance, was sixth in 1m at 166.75.
Kylie Price was the other Jimmie in the national meet, finishing 30th of 48 swimmers in the 50 free with a time of 24.86 and 30th of 44 in the 100 free at 54.22.
